POWER RELAY
1 POLE--8 A
(MEDIUM LOAD CONTROL)
JS SERIES
s FEATURES
q q q q
q
q
q
q
UL, CSA, VDE, SEV, SEMKO, FIMKO, ÖVE, BSI recognized UL class B (130°C) insulation 1 form A (SPST-NO) or 1 form C (SPDT) contact Low profile and space saving--Height: 12.5 mm --Mounting space: 290 mm2 High sensitivity in small package --Operating power ... 0.11 to 0.14 W --Nominal power ...... 0.22 to 0.29 W High isolation in small package --Insulation distance : 8 mm --Dielectric strength : 5,000 VAC (between coil and contacts) --Surge strength : 10,000 V Plastic materials --UL 94 flame class V-0 --UL CTI level class 2 Plastic sealed type

s COIL DATA CHART
MODEL JS- 5 (M) (E, N) -K (T) JS- 6 (M) (E, N) -K (T) JS- 9 (M) (E, N) -K (T) JS-12 (M) (E, N) -K (T) JS-18 (M) (E, N) -K (T) JS-24 (M) (E, N) -K (T) JS-48 (M) (E, N) -K (T) JS-60 (M) (E, N) -K (T) Nominal voltage 5 VDC 6 VDC 9 VDC 12 VDC 18 VDC 24 VDC 48 VDC 60 VDC Coil resistance (±10%) 112 160 360 660 1,455 2,350 8,000 12,500 Must operate voltage 3.5 VDC 4.2 VDC 6.3 VDC 8.5 VDC 12.7 VDC 16.8 VDC 33.4 VDC 41.7 VDC Must release voltage 0.5 VDC 0.6 VDC 0.9 VDC 1.2 VDC 1.8 VDC 2.4 VDC 4.8 VDC 6.0 VDC Nominal power 225 mW 225 mW 225 mW 220 mW 225 mW 245 mW 290 mW 290 mW
Note : All values in the table are measured at 20°C.
